About Josefa Del Rio Guerrero

Josefa Del Rio Guerrero is a public high school in Morovis, PR, part of PUERTO RICO DEPARTMENT OF EDUCATION. Josefa Del Rio Guerrero serves approximately 402 students, and covers grades 9th-12th, and has a 14.4:1 student-teacher ratio. Josefa Del Rio Guerrero has a current MySchoolScout rating of 6.1 out of 10 and ranks #452 of 842 schools in PR.

Structured state assessment records for Josefa Del Rio Guerrero show 6%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2018) and 48%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2018).

What Parents Should Know

Located in a rural area, Josefa Del Rio Guerrero may involve longer commutes for some families. Rural schools often serve as community anchors and may have smaller class sizes, but parents should consider transportation logistics, after-school program availability, and access to specialized services.

The chronic absenteeism rate at Josefa Del Rio Guerrero was 76% in the 2022-23 school year, which is above the national average. Chronic absenteeism (missing 15 or more school days) can affect classroom dynamics and pacing. Parents should ask about the school's attendance support programs and what resources are available to help families address barriers to consistent attendance.

How We Rate Schools

Every school receives a composite score from 1 to 10 built from student growth, poverty-adjusted academics, and learning environment — plus college readiness for high schools. Weights vary by school level, with growth counting most in elementary and middle grades. Equity data is shown for context but is not factored into the score. Scores are built from publicly available data including standardized test results, enrollment figures, and school climate indicators.
